SY100E222L. A 2:1 input multiplexer selects from two
differential input pairs by means of the CLK_SEL input select.
banks generates a ÷1 or ÷2 frequency of the selected input.
The ÷1/÷2 divider outputs can be asynchronously
synchronized with the master reset (MR) input so that the
outputs will start out in a known state.
selected output banks in a 2/3/4/6 fanout configuration. Each
of the four banks can independently select the ÷1 or ÷2
output frequency by means of the four separate frequency
select pins (FSELA-FSELD) inputs.
